Enhancement: "Everything is ok" message after retrying
When a recoverable error is encountered, restic displays a warning message
saying it's retrying, like this one:
Save(<data/956b9ced99>) returned error, retrying after 357.131936ms: CreateBlockBlobFromReader: Put https://example.blob.core.windows.net/restic/data/95/956b9ced99...aac: write tcp 192.168.11.18:51620->1.2.3.4:443: write: connection reset by peer
This message can be a little confusing because it seems like there was an
error, but we're not sure if it was actually fixed by retrying.
restic is now displaying a confirmation that the action was successful after retrying:
Save(<data/956b9ced99>) operation successful after 1 retries

// retryNotifyErrorWithSuccess is an extension of backoff.RetryNotify with notification of success after an error.
// success is NOT notified on the first run of operation (only after an error).
func retryNotifyErrorWithSuccess(operation backoff.Operation, b backoff.BackOff, notify backoff.Notify, success func(retries int)) error {
if success == nil {
return backoff.RetryNotify(operation, b, notify)
}
retries := 0
operationWrapper := func() error {
err := operation()
if err != nil {
retries++
} else if retries > 0 {
success(retries)
}
return err
}
return backoff.RetryNotify(operationWrapper, b, notify)
}
